13647, ATHENIAN, Paris, Musée du Louvre, F358

  • Vase Number: 13647
  • Fabric: ATHENIAN
  • Technique: BLACK-FIGURE
  • Shape Name: LEKYTHOS
  • Date: -525 to -475
  • Decoration: Body: MAN AND YOUTH LEADING HORSES
  • Last Recorded Collection: Paris, Musée du Louvre: F358
  • Publication Record: American Journal of Archaeology: 54 (1950), 314, FIG.3
    Cronache di archeologia e di storia dell'arte: 10 (1971), PL.21, FIGS.3-5
  • AVI Web: https://www.avi.unibas.ch/DB/searchform.html?ID=6609
  • AVI Record Number: 6373
  • CAVI Collection: Paris, Louvre F 358.
  • CAVI Lemma: BF lekythos. Unattributed. Early fifth.
  • CAVI Subject: A man and a youth, each leading a horse.
  • CAVI Inscriptions: In large letters between the horses, in a double curve: ὀνῖσθέ με καὶ εὖ ἐ[μ]πολέσει. Above the right horse (i.e., above the youth leading it): καλος.
  • CAVI Comments: The reading of the letters is mine; I have omitted two single dots, one after και, the other after the lambda, as they seem accidental. The interpretation is Beazley's, except that I take the last word to be second singular middle. Note the change from plural to singular in the verbs. Is it: `Help me [by buying] and you will do good business'? Cf. χαιρε και πριο με(?).
  • CAVI Number: 6373
  • AVI Bibliography: Beazley (1950), 315-16, fig. 3.
